Accounts still listed after DRO

I was issued a DRO in April 2014. It was closed 12 months later and I understood all accounts would be closed and that would be the end of the matter. I recently signed up to credit karma and I’m dismayed to find that two debts are still listed on there and have been listed as defaulting on payments since 2014. One of them is PayDay UK, and it doesn’t match any information listed in my DRO, even though I am 100% certain it was included, there will have been no logical reason for me to excluded anything. The other is JD Williams. I’m pretty annoyed that I now have two debts showing almost 6 years of default payments. What can I do about this?

    What you should have done at the end of your 12 month deferment period, perform a credit file clean up.

    Not all creditors are aware of how to mark your file in a DRO, all accounts should show as settled, or satisfied, with a zero balance.

    Any that do not, send a written complaint asking them to correct the error, if they don’t or won’t, escalate to the ICO.

  • I had this issue after my DRO. 

    Just send a letter to the data controller of the company in question. Template below from another site. They should sort it out.

    2) Creditor doesn’t mark debt as satisfied when your DRO has finished

    The creditor doesn’t have to mark the debt as fully settled/satisfied so there is no point in complaining if the debt has been marked as partially settled/satisfied.

    If the debt isn’t showing as closed with a zero balance four months after your DRO has finished, send the following letter to the data controller for the creditor:

    re: [account/reference x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x]

    My Debt Relief Order finished on dd/mm/yyyy. I attach a copy of my Insolvency Service Register entry which shows this.

    I am writing to ask you to correct my credit file for the above debt.  The ICO guidelines state that my credit file should show that I no longer owe money on that account, perhaps by marking the entry as ‘partially satisfied’ or ‘partially settled’ or in some other way.

    Please correct this entry within 28 days or supply me with a written reason why you will not do so.
